How to Reach

There are several ways to reach Minneriya National Park from Divulapitiya:

  • By bus: The most economical option is to take a bus from Divulapitiya to Dambulla and then transfer to a bus to Minneriya National Park. The journey takes approximately 6 hours and costs around LKR 500.
  • By train: You can also take a train from Divulapitiya to Dambulla and then transfer to a bus to Minneriya National Park. The journey takes approximately 5 hours and costs around LKR 300.
  • By taxi: The most convenient option is to take a taxi from Divulapitiya to Minneriya National Park. The journey takes approximately 4 hours and costs around LKR 5,000.

Best time to go

The best time to visit Minneriya National Park is during the dry season, which runs from December to April. During this time, the weather is clear and the animals are more active.
